如何调试和优化DeepSeek智能对话的响应速度

在人工智能的浪潮中,DeepSeek智能对话系统以其独特的优势成为了众多企业争相应用的对象。然而,在实际应用过程中,如何调试和优化DeepSeek智能对话的响应速度成为了许多开发者和企业关注的焦点。本文将讲述一位资深工程师在调试和优化DeepSeek智能对话响应速度过程中的心路历程。

故事的主人公名叫李明,他是一位在人工智能领域深耕多年的工程师。某天,李明所在的公司接到了一个项目,要求他们开发一款基于DeepSeek智能对话的客服系统。这个系统需要在短时间内响应用户的咨询,并提供准确的答案。然而,在实际开发过程中,李明发现DeepSeek智能对话的响应速度并不尽如人意。

在项目初期,李明和他的团队按照常规思路进行开发。他们首先对DeepSeek智能对话系统进行了初步的配置和调试,然后将其集成到客服系统中。然而,在实际运行过程中,系统响应速度缓慢,甚至有时会出现卡顿现象。这让李明深感困惑,于是他决定深入探究原因。

李明首先对DeepSeek智能对话系统的代码进行了仔细分析。他发现,在处理用户输入时,系统需要进行大量的数据处理和计算。这导致了响应速度缓慢。为了解决这个问题,李明尝试对代码进行优化。

在优化过程中,李明遇到了以下几个关键问题:

  1. 数据处理速度慢:DeepSeek智能对话系统需要处理大量的文本数据,包括用户输入和系统回复。为了提高数据处理速度,李明考虑了以下几种方案:

(1)使用并行处理:将数据处理任务分配到多个线程或进程中,实现并行处理,从而提高效率。

(2)优化算法:对现有算法进行优化,减少计算量,提高处理速度。

(3)使用更高效的数据结构:选择合适的数据结构,提高数据访问速度。


  1. 通信开销大:DeepSeek智能对话系统需要与后端服务器进行通信,获取用户信息和知识库。为了减少通信开销,李明尝试了以下几种方法:

(1)缓存:将常用数据缓存到本地,减少与后端服务器的通信次数。

(2)异步通信:使用异步通信方式,避免阻塞主线程,提高响应速度。

(3)压缩数据:对传输数据进行压缩,减少数据传输量。


  1. 服务器性能瓶颈:在调试过程中,李明发现服务器性能成为制约响应速度的关键因素。为了解决这个问题,他采取了以下措施:

(1)优化服务器配置:调整服务器硬件和软件配置,提高处理能力。

(2)负载均衡:将请求分发到多台服务器,减轻单台服务器的压力。

(3)缓存热点数据:将频繁访问的数据缓存到内存中,提高访问速度。

在经过一段时间的努力后,李明终于找到了解决问题的方法。他通过并行处理、优化算法、使用高效数据结构、异步通信、缓存、压缩数据、优化服务器配置、负载均衡和缓存热点数据等多种手段,成功地将DeepSeek智能对话系统的响应速度提升了数倍。

以下是李明在优化过程中的一些心得体会:

  1. 深入了解系统:在调试和优化过程中,首先要对系统进行全面了解,包括代码结构、数据处理流程、通信机制等。

  2. 逐步优化:针对系统中的关键问题,逐一进行优化,逐步提升系统性能。

  3. 持续监控:优化完成后,要持续监控系统性能,确保优化效果。

  4. 团队协作:优化过程中,需要与团队成员密切配合,共同解决问题。

  5. 不断学习:人工智能领域技术更新迅速,要不断学习新知识,提高自己的技术水平。

通过这次优化经历,李明不仅提高了DeepSeek智能对话系统的响应速度,还积累了宝贵的经验。他相信,在人工智能技术的不断发展下,DeepSeek智能对话系统将会在更多场景中得到应用,为人们的生活带来更多便利。

猜你喜欢:AI翻译